Summary

Council approved FY2024 budget amendments that increased the general fund by $5.15 million to account for capital leases, vehicle acquisitions and reallocations across SPLOST and other funds; staff said the audit begins next week.

At the April 21 meeting, Holly Springs city staff presented detailed amendments to the FY2024 budget and the City Council voted unanimously to adopt the changes.

Rob, a city staff member who presented the proposals, said the changes follow accrual adjustments and receipt of equipment ordered earlier: "So we are to the point that we're ready to make the recommended changes to our 2024 budget," he said. The council approved the ordinance adopting those amendments.
